LeBron James has joined the Philadelphia 76ers on a two-year contract. Speculation surrounding his son, Bronny James, potentially joining him has been addressed, with ESPN reporting that there is 'no current plan or request' for this move. Rich Paul, their agent, indicated they are not a package deal. Bronny's development continues with the Lakers, having shown some improvement during last season but still facing stiff competition for playing time within the team's deep guard lineup. He has two years remaining on his contract with the Lakers, which includes a team option for the 2027-28 season.
